Aerospace series - Lockbolts, protruding head, sheartype, close tolerance, in titanium alloy TI-P64001, anodized, metric series - Classification: 1 100 MPa (at ambient temperature) / 315 °C
This standard specifies the characteristics of lockbolts with protruding head, sheartype, close tolerance, in titanium alloy TI-P64001, anodized, metric series, for use in aerospace applications.
Classification : 1 100 MPa / 315 °C
In both versions, i.e. with and without pintail these lockbolts fulfill the same function when installed and are statically / dynamically equivalent.
They are intended to be used with collars to EN 4174 or EN 4175.

Overview
EN 4172:2006 defines the characteristics of aerospace lockbolts - protruding head, shear-type, close tolerance - manufactured in titanium alloy TI‑P64001, anodized, metric series. The standard is intended for structural aerospace use and carries the material classification: 1 100 MPa (at ambient temperature) / 315 °C. Both versions - with pintail (version P) and without pintail (version S) - are statically and dynamically equivalent when installed. These lockbolts are intended to be used with collars conforming to EN 4174 or EN 4175.
Key Topics
- Scope and classification: Defines intended aerospace applications and the tensile/temperature classification (1 100 MPa / 315 °C).
- Configuration and dimensions: Metric geometry, close-tolerance dimensions and mass values are specified (diameter and length codes, tolerances apply after surface treatment).
- Versions: Version P (pull-type with pintail) and version S (stub-type without pintail) - both functionally equivalent in service.
- Materials: Titanium alloy per TR 3775 (TI‑P64001) - strength class as above.
- Surface treatment and lubrication:
- Anodizing per EN 2808 (titanium anodizing).
- Lubrication guidance referencing MIL‑L‑87132 (cetyl alcohol).
- Marking and identification: Marking style per EN 2424, and prescribed description/identity block formats (example: EN4172P040–140G).
- Technical specification / procurement: Detailed technical requirements and test/spec references are covered and cross-referenced to EN 4176 for related lockbolt specifications.
- Normative references: Lists the essential standards and technical reports needed to apply EN 4172.
